I’ve always loved books. They’ve been a constant companion, guiding me through life, business, and my own personal healing journey.

Some books entertain, others inspire, but every so often, you come across one that truly shifts the way you see the world, and yourself.


Here are six that set me on a path I could never have imagined:


  1. The Secret – Rhonda Byrne

A gateway into the power of intention and energy, and the spark that opened me up to a whole new way of thinking.


  1. The Power of Now – Eckhart Tolle

A reminder that peace is only ever found in this present moment.


  1. The Source – Dr Tara Swart

Blending neuroscience with spirituality, helping me understand how powerful the brain really is.


  1. The Biology of Belief – Dr Bruce Lipton

The book that showed me the science of how our beliefs influence our biology and health.


  1. The Universe Has Your Back – Gabrielle Bernstein

A comforting, practical guide for trusting life, even when it feels uncertain.


  1. Why Woo Woo Works – Dr David Hamilton

A fascinating look at the science behind holistic practices, and why they have such a powerful impact.


📚 Each of these books has helped me peel back another layer of understanding, and together they’ve paved the way for the work I now do with others, guiding them through transformation, healing, and growth.
